Golden color with a thin off white head out of the bottle. Big juicy tropical fruit and grapefruit zest nose. Very bitter beer with lots of hop resin, raw hop pellets and grapefruit rind, cut only with a little caramel sweetness. Long grassy green finish. Almost too coarse for me.

Pour is hazy copper with orange edges and tons of billowy off white head. The nose is citrusy with toasted grain and a fair bit of peppery spice, almost rye like. The taste shows a fair bit of toasted grain, bread crust, hops in back. Citrus, virtually no bitterness, grain lingers with assertive carbonation and a medium body. Bit of sourness in the finish, may have a very slight infection but doesn’t take away from the beer.
